THE PRIME MINISTER RESPONDS TO THE RESIGNATION OF THE PREMIER OF QUEBEC

January 11, 2001
Ottawa, Ontario

Prime Minister Jean Chrétien today issued this statement in response to the news of Premier Lucien Bouchard’s resignation:

"While our visions of the future of Quebec in Canada were fundamentally irreconcilable, I want to salute Lucien Bouchard as an able parliamentarian who has fought for his beliefs with passion and determination.

All those who serve the public understand the tremendous sacrifices that they have to make to succeed in carrying out their mandate. There is no doubt that Mr. Bouchard devoted his energies completely to that end.

As he brings his time in public life to a close, Aline joins me in sincerely wishing every success to him, Mrs. Audrey Best and their children as they open a new chapter in their lives."
